Effective - 28 Aug 1992

340.330. Disciplinary action against technician authorized, when. — The provisions and causes of actions as set forth under section 340.264 are applicable to veterinary technicians in all respects. The board may, also, take disciplinary action against a veterinary technician if the technician:

(1) Solicits patients from any licensed veterinarian;

(2) Solicits or receives any form of compensation from any person for services rendered other than from the veterinarian under whom the technician is employed;

(3) Willfully or negligently divulges a professional confidence or discusses a veterinarian's diagnosis or treatment without the express permission of the veterinarian; or

(4) Demonstrates a manifest incapability or incompetence to perform as a veterinary technician.

­­--------

(L. 1992 H.B. 878 § 65)
